Blood-soaked body of VIP chief’s father found in Bihar home | India News – Times of India

PATNA: Vikassheel Insaan Party chief Mukesh Sahani‘s father was found murdered Tuesday in their ancestral village home in Bihar‘s Darbhanga. The body of 70-year-old Jitan Sahani, who lived alone, was discovered by a man delivering flowers around 6.30 am. Niti Aayog reconstituted: Shivraj Singh Chouhan, HD Kumaraswamy, Chirag Paswan among new members | India News – Times of India

NEW DELHI: The Central government on Tuesday re-organised the composition of the Niti Aayog and inducted representatives from the ally parties of the National Democratic Alliance.
